PS3 Release Delayed in Japan - PS2, All

15th March 2006, 1:51pm
It appears as if the Sony Playstation 3 has been delayed yet again in Japan until the end of the year. An official statement by Sony has not been released, but the Japanese press has published that the PS3 will not be released until November 2006 in Japan.

Apparently the delay is due to the Blu-Ray storage format, and finalising the copy-protection system to ensure the system is adequately secured.

What does this mean for Australian Gamers? This will mean that there is a high probability that we won't see the Playstation 3 here until the Christmas season in 2007, even later. This will obviously give the XBOX 360 a large 18 month inroad to build up sales, and build a well established user-base.

We also speculate Sony will probably find it difficult to push the current PS2 as time goes by, compared to the sparkle of the next generation Xbox 360.
